What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Auto Remarketing Spec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Auto Remarketing Specialist, you need a solid understanding of automotive markets, remarketing strategies, and strong analytical skills, often supported by experience in auto sales or fleet management. Familiarity with online auction platforms, CRM systems, and automotive inventory management tools is typically required. Excellent communication, negotiation skills, and attention to detail help build relationships with clients and ensure smooth transactions. These skills are crucial for maximizing vehicle value, efficiently managing inventory, and maintaining client satisfaction in a competitive remote environment.

What is Remote Auto Remarketing?

Remote Auto Remarketing involves managing the process of reselling used or off-lease vehicles from a distance, using digital tools and online platforms. Professionals in this field coordinate vehicle inspections, auctions, pricing, and sales without needing to be physically present at a dealership or auction site. This job requires knowledge of the automotive market, strong communication skills, and proficiency with online remarketing technologies. It is increasingly popular as the automotive industry embraces digital transformation, allowing for greater efficiency and reach in the vehicle resale process.

Job Summary:

P&C Private Client Group (PCG/affluent lines) is a division of NFP Property & Casualty. We are a retail operation for affluent and wealthy individuals and families seeking personal lines products in the United States, parts of Europe, and Canada. Our headquarters are in New York City with offices across the country - specializing in insurance ranging from homeowners and auto to specialty lines, such as aircraft and watercraft.

The Role at NFP: 

The Account Executive interacts with clients on a day-to-day basis while developing and maintaining relationships with both client and carrier representatives. You will prepare applications, specifications and marketing strategy for new business as well as the renewals of assigned clients with some degree of supervision and approval from their Supervisor. This role may require supporting a Team Lead and will have the expectation of growth to take on the role of lead consultant and primary point of contact for their assigned clients.  The Account Executive may have revenue goals and/or client retention targets. This is a servicing, not a sales (new production) or staff management role. Growth and advancements are within the career trajectory.

This role will ideally report to our NYC, Wall Street office on a hybrid work schedule. We will consider remote options for highly qualified candidates with experience in High-Net-Worth Personal Lines and who can work on EST schedule. Title and salary will be commensurate with experience and knowledge.
